Rms "Magdalena"

Volume 464: debated on Wednesday 11 May 1949

The text on this page has been created from Hansard archive content, it may contain typographical errors.

41.

asked the Parliamentary Secretary to the Admiralty whether the plates of the R.M.S. "Magdalena" are riveted or welded.

The whole of the shell plating of the R.M.S. "Magdalena" was riveted and all deck beams, ship's side-frames and double-bottom floors were riveted to the plating. The plates for decks, bulkheads and tank tops were welded.
